Dream Maker Grant Announced, UP To $5,000 in Assistance for 1st Time Military Buyers

Pentagon Federal Credit Union has announced a grant program for Active Duty, Reserve, Guard and Veterans.  The program, known as Dream Makers, offers applicants up to $5,000 in assistance for 1st Time Military buyers.

There are restrictions of course, such as income amd mandatory attendance of a home buying class.  The program is intended to help famillies of modest means, with a Maximum Income of $55,000  OR 80% of the areas median family income.

If the family remains in the home for 5 years, the grant does not have to be repaid, or if you have to sale the home early due to PCS orders.  Otherwise, repayment on a sliding scale according to how long you stayed in the home is required.  You could also rent thome out upon transfer, and not have to repay the grant as well.
